Video Glitcher v0.2.2

Video Glitcher is a desktop editor for combining video clips, an audio track, procedural retro visuals, and smooth seeded glitch events.

Included

  • Import and reorder multiple video clips.
  • Preserve each source's full aspect ratio by default, with optional crop-to-fill or stretch sizing.
  • Match a new project's canvas and default export dimensions to its first imported video (for example, a 640×360 source exports at 640×360 by default).
  • Confine glitches and CRT processing to the visible source rectangle, leaving letterbox and pillarbox areas untouched.
  • Use MP3, OGG, WAV, FLAC, AAC, M4A, or a video's audio stream as the soundtrack.
  • Hear the soundtrack during editor playback, including after pausing or seeking.
  • Set both the soundtrack's source in-point and its start position on the video timeline.
  • Add infinite procedural Neon Grid, Synth Sun, Plasma Field, and Analog Static clips.
  • Apply twenty animated retro effects with smooth attack and recovery envelopes: the six original Glitcher effects plus fourteen additional processors.
  • Choose from 63 curated presets; every event stores its preset parameters so saved projects remain visually stable as defaults evolve.
  • Use six TV Reception modes, including full-frame Heavy Snow without an unintended moving wipe boundary.
  • Add individual effects at the playhead or generate an entire seeded sequence.
  • Continuously fill either the selected clip or every clip with randomized effects that stay inside clip boundaries.
  • Replace or reroll individual generated events without changing their position or duration.
  • Use fixed duration or a randomized duration range, density, intensity, and meld controls.
  • Preview the actual rendering pipeline used by export.
  • Save and reopen .glitcher.json projects.
  • Detect working NVIDIA NVENC, Intel Quick Sync, and AMD AMF H.264 encoders at startup.
  • Choose automatic, GPU, or CPU encoding in the export dialog, with automatic CPU fallback if hardware encoding fails.
  • Stream rendered frames directly into FFmpeg instead of writing and re-encoding an intermediate video.
  • Show the active CPU/GPU encoder, frame progress, elapsed time, and a smoothed time-remaining estimate while exporting.
  • Export H.264 MP4 with AAC audio through FFmpeg.

Effects and presets

  • VHS Tracking Failure: Original, Loose Tracking, Tracking Storm
  • RGB Ghost: Original, Soft Echo, Wide Separation
  • Neon Signal Collapse: Original, Candy Breakdown, Total Collapse
  • Static Reconstruction: Original, Color Snow, Coarse Rebuild
  • Vertical Sync Roll: Original, Slow Roll, Hard Flip
  • Video Feedback: Original, Soft Tunnel, Deep Spiral
  • Glow: Soft Bloom, Neon Halo, Dream Bloom
  • Chromatic Aberration: Subtle Fringe, Signal Split, Prism Tear
  • Color Adjustment: Faded Tape, Cold CRT, Acid Neon
  • Gaussian Blur: Soft Focus, Analog Smear, Defocus
  • Pixelate: Fine Pixels, 8-Bit Blocks, Chunky Signal
  • Scanlines: Fine Display, Classic CRT, Heavy Raster
  • TV Reception: Weak Reception, Heavy Snow, Horizontal Sync, Rolling Bands, Color Interference, Signal Dropouts
  • Row Glitch: Light Tearing, Tracking Failure, Digital Break
  • JPEG Glitch: Compression Haze, Corrupted Tape, Data Collapse
  • Posterize: Retro Color, Limited Palette, Monochrome Terminal
  • Sine Modulation: Gentle Ripple, Tape Wave, Signal Melt
  • Halftone: Fine Print, Newspaper, Pop Art
  • CMYK Halftone: Fine Registration, Classic Print, Bold Misprint
  • Declarative Shader: CRT, VHS, Arcade Monitor
